We make your Machu Picchu one day hike hassle-free from the very start. Your comfortable hotel pick-up is included, beginning promptly at 4:00 AM from Cusco or 5:30 AM from Ollantaytambo. If you're staying in Urubamba, we can coordinate your pick-up as well. Don't worry about your extra luggage; we can help you store your extra luggage at Kenko Adventures office while you're on tour, and then seamlessly transfer it to your next hotel in Cusco or a different location.
Your adventure kicks off aboard the Expedition Tourist Class Train at approximately 5:40 AM, heading directly to Km 104. This scenic journey offers a comfortable prelude to your trek, immersing you in the stunning landscapes of the Sacred Valley and its vibrant, dense vegetation as we approach the Chachabamba train station. This train segment highlights one of The Many Ways to Reach Machu Picchu, setting the stage for your incredible day.
Your One Day Inca Trail hike truly begins around 7:30 AM with an insightful visit to the Chachabamba archaeological site. Here, we delve into its historical significance, uncovering secrets of The Inca Culture History before continuing our trek. Our path winds through fascinating geography, alive with diverse wildlife & flora found in the Inca Trail. We'll soon reach the beautiful Wiñayhuayna waterfall, and by approximately 10:30 AM, we’ll arrive at the magnificent Wiñayhuayna archaeological site. Known for its ancient function as an agricultural experimentation center with spectacular views, this location marks the culmination of the harder part of this Short Inca Trail.
By 11:00 AM, our group reaches the Wiñayhuayna campsite, which also serves as the final resting point for our Classic Inca Trail adventurers, highlighting the shared heritage of these iconic routes. After a moderate trek filled with both ascents and descents, at 12:15 PM, we are rewarded with the awe-inspiring sight of Inti Punku, offering your first stunning panoramic view of Machu Picchu. This is an ideal spot for a well-deserved lunch, providing a Machu Picchu view through Sungate unlike any other.
At 1:00 PM, you will step into Machu Picchu itself, ready for incredible postcard pictures and unforgettable photo opportunities. We then embark on an extensive 2.5-hour walking tour of Machu Picchu via circuit number 1, widely considered the best Machu Picchu tour to experience the citadel's wonders, concluding around 4:30 PM. We recommend checking our Machu Picchu Maps for context and reviewing Everything You Should Know Before Venturing on the Inca Trail for comprehensive preparation.
At 5:00 PM, we depart Machu Picchu, taking a comfortable bus down to Aguas Calientes. The return journey continues at 6:00 PM aboard the luxurious Vistadome Train to Ollantaytambo, arriving around 8:00 PM. From there, a private car will comfortably transfer you back to Cusco, concluding our service by approximately 9:30 PM. How difficult is the one day hike to Machu Picchu?
The one-day hike to Machu Picchu, is considered moderately challenging and is suitable for individuals with a reasonable level of fitness. The trek covers approximately 7.5 miles (12 kilometers) and includes a mix of uphill and downhill sections, along with some steep and uneven terrain. Hikers can expect to walk for about 6-7 hours, depending on their pace and the number of stops made to admire the stunning scenery and archaeological sites along the way. While it requires some effort, the hike is achievable for most people and is immensely rewarding, offering breathtaking views and a profound sense of accomplishment upon reaching the Sun Gate (Inti Punku) and seeing Machu Picchu for the first time. How is the climate in Cusco?
The climate in Peru is highly variable and does not conform to the typical four seasons. Here in the Andes, you can experience all seasons in a single day! This is why we always recommend our visitors prepare for any occasion, whether it's for rain or sunny days. A significant factor affecting our global climate is global warming, which has contributed to glacier melting in the Peruvian Andes, impacting our weather patterns. Nonetheless, Peru, and particularly Andean cities like Cusco, have two main seasons:
- Dry Season: Generally from the end of April until the end of September, with the first rains beginning towards the end of this period. This is often considered the best time to visit our region and the amazing Machu Picchu to avoid inconveniences.
- Rainy Season: This season typically runs from October until the end of April. During this time, we advise all visitors to pack their belongings into waterproof bags, as sunny mornings can quickly turn into heavy rain. Huayna Picchu Mountain (What is this hike, and how do I book it?)
This iconic Huayna Picchu Mountain is located within Machu Picchu Archaeological Park, towering approximately 300 meters above the citadel. The hike typically takes about 45 minutes to ascend and another 45 minutes to descend. This Mountain preserves fascinating archaeological remains, such as the Moon Temple, and other precincts interconnected by authentic trails, steps, tunnels, and natural caves, making the view incredibly interesting. Without a doubt, this is one of the best attractions of Machu Picchu; the Huayna Picchu Mountain offers a 360-degree view and a stunning panorama of Machu Picchu Inca Citadel, Machu Picchu Mountain, and the famous Inti Punku (Sun’s Gate). Currently, the Peruvian government, through the Ministry of Culture, controls visitor entry, offering only 400 tickets per day, divided into two groups of 200 each (7:00-8:00 AM and 10:00-11:00 AM schedules). Due to high demand, it is necessary to make a booking at least 3 months in advance to guarantee your visit to this extraordinary place.

Machu Picchu Mountain (What is this hike, and how do I book it?)
This majestic Machu Picchu Mountain is also located inside the park, a hike of only 1 hour and 20 minutes on your own. Once you reach the summit, you will capture impressive photos with panoramic views of the entire valley, encompassing Machu Picchu Inca citadel, impressive vistas of the Andes Mountain range, and the glaciers that protect this unique ecosystem. The demand for permits for this hike is growing quickly, so we advise booking tickets a minimum of 2 months in advance, as there is a limit of 200 people per group per schedule (7:00-8:00 AM and 9:00-10:00 AM).
